Most industry observers have already noted the March export record: 349,000 NEVs shipped overseas, up 139.9% year-on-year [0†L5-L6][5†L7-L8]. But the numbers that tell a more structural story are these:

On the demand side, Brent crude surged past $100 per barrel in April, driven by Middle East tensions and the blockade of the Strait of Hormuz [10†L6-L9][11†L8-L9].

On the supply side, China‘s installed NEV production capacity stands at approximately 20 million units annually, with current utilization at roughly 40% [7†L3-L4][7†L11].

This is not a coincidence. It is a structural convergence. High oil prices create immediate demand for affordable EVs. China has the spare capacity to fill that demand—right now, at scale, with no other region able to match the speed. The result is not a temporary export spike. It is an acceleration of Chinese NEV market penetration globally, happening at least three years faster than most analysts predicted 12 months ago.

  1. The supply-demand convergence is not temporary The April oil price spike is not an isolated event—geopolitical tensions in the Middle East have shown no signs of easing. But even if oil prices moderate, the structural condition has changed: consumers in Europe, Southeast Asia, and Latin America have now experienced what $100+ oil feels like. The operating cost advantage of EVs is no longer an abstract calculation—it is a lived reality. On the supply side, China‘s spare capacity is not a short-term surplus. According to industry estimates, China’s NEV production capacity is roughly double its current utilization [7†L3-L4][7†L11]. Battery capacity is even more oversized—global supply is projected to remain at least three times demand through 2026, with China-based producers accounting for the vast majority of that excess [8†L5-L7]. This is not a cyclical surplus. It is a structural overhang that will take years to absorb—and in the meantime, it exerts continuous downward pressure on EV prices globally. 2. This changes the economics of market entry for Chinese OEMs When a Chinese automaker decides to enter a new overseas market, the traditional challenge has been building brand awareness and dealer networks. High oil prices lower that barrier. A consumer facing $100/barrel fuel costs is less concerned about brand heritage and more concerned about total cost of ownership. Chinese EVs, priced competitively even before tariffs, become the rational choice. Moreover, the availability of spare capacity means Chinese OEMs can respond to demand surges faster than competitors. If a market opens—whether through a tariff reduction, a policy change, or a fuel price shock—Chinese factories can ramp up production in weeks, not years. This speed-to-market advantage is a strategic asset that no other region can currently match. 3. For aftermarket and distribution partners, the clock is ticking With 349,000 NEVs exported in March alone [6†L8], the pipeline of Chinese EVs entering overseas markets is filling fast. For aftermarket parts distributors in Europe, Southeast Asia, and Latin America, this means the vehicle population is arriving now—and service demand will follow in 12-24 months. Distributors that build inventory of compatible components (battery cooling parts, high-voltage connectors, ADAS sensors) before demand materializes will capture market share. Those that wait until vehicles are already on the road will find themselves competing for limited supply. 4. The battery supply chain advantage is the ultimate enabler Behind every Chinese EV export is a battery supply chain that no other region can replicate. Chinese battery producers account for over 70% of global production capacity, with the top six Chinese firms holding a combined 68.8% of global market share [9†L3-L4][2†L22-L24]. This concentration means Chinese OEMs have a fundamental cost advantage in the most expensive component of an EV. When oil prices spike, that advantage becomes decisive.
